Designer | Architecture

BHDP Architecture · Charlotte, NC · 3 wk ago

Responsibilities

  • Independently delivers assigned deliverable packages and details that are accurate, complete, coordinated, and issued on time.
  • Mets BHDP quality expectations through project coordination, accurate incorporation of manager feedback, and QA/QC follow through—minimizing repeat comments and rework within assigned scope.
  • Demonstrates growing proficiency coordinating assigned scope with project systems and consultant inputs, identifying conflicts early and resolving routine issues with increasing independence.
  • Escalates higher-risk items appropriately and applies lessons learned to reduce repeat coordination issues.
  • Uses and shares reusable content (templates, checklists, standards tips, lessons learned) from the agreed BHDP standards repository to improve team consistency.
  • Learns from and coaches others and supports developing teammates through short feedback loops to drive standards adoption, reduce recurring issues, and improve throughput.
  • Communicates clear status, roadblocks, and next steps to the project team and/or manager with timely follow-through, documenting decisions and action items as directed.
  • Works with others and cooperates effectively to resolve issues within assigned scope, implement decisions consistently in deliverables, and give and receive feedback professionally.
  • Manages assigned scope to meet milestones and hours-to-plan, escalating scope/time risks early with clear recovery options and documented next steps.
  • SUBMIT ACCURATE, ON-TIME WEEKLY TIMESHEETS FOR CLIENT BILLING AND UNDERSTANDS HOW TIMEKEEPING AND UTILIZATION IMPACT PROJECT ACCOUNTING, FEE PERFORMANCE, AND PROFITABILITY.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or of Architecture degree (NAAB accredited program preferred)
  • 3+ years in the design and architecture industry
  • NCARB Record + AXP progress preferred
  • Revit proficiency - independently deliver defined drawing packages/projects
  • Proficiency in production-ready visualization capabilities (SketchUp, Enscape, Lumion)
  • Desire and willingness to learn
  • Demonstrated initiative; sees challenges as opportunities
  • Strong attention to detail
  • Strong communication and collaboration within a team
  • Consistently demonstrates a high level of professionalism in client-facing and internal interactions, including responsiveness, confidentiality, and strong service orientation.
